Optical Properties of One-Dimensional Multi-Layered Structures Containing Plasma Materials
The optical properties of electromagnetic (EM) waves propagating in one-dimensional plasma dielectric photonic crystal made of alternate thin layers of two materials namely micro plasma layer and dielectric material layer is studied theoretically. The dispersions both for ω < ωp and ω >ωp are deduced by transfer matrix method and the photonic band gap structure and the reflection spectra are computed. The results show that the band gap structure and reflection spectra are tuned correspondingly due to the dielectric constant of the microplasma layer modified differently in different frequency ranges. Parameter dependence of the effects is calculated and discussed.
